Page 1 sur 1

OLAP est en erreur

Posté : sam. janv. 21, 2017 3:20 pm
par wawa_1
Bonjour, je vient de lancer OLAP Business et voila une erreur:

OLAP init error

Mondrian Error:Internal error: while parsing catalog file:C:/Users/utilisateur/AppData/Local/Temp/openconcerto2569619356526396511.xml
org.openconcerto.utils.ExceptionHandler: OLAP init error
at org.openconcerto.utils.ExceptionHandler.handle(ExceptionHandler.java:121)
at org.openconcerto.utils.ExceptionHandler.handle(ExceptionHandler.java:125)
at org.openconcerto.modules.reports.olap.OLAPPanel.reload(OLAPPanel.java:61)
at org.openconcerto.modules.reports.olap.OLAPPanel$1.actionPerformed(OLAPPanel.java:66)
at javax.swing.AbstractButton.fireActionPerformed(Unknown Source)
at javax.swing.AbstractButton$Handler.actionPerformed(Unknown Source)
at javax.swing.DefaultButtonModel.fireActionPerformed(Unknown Source)
at javax.swing.DefaultButtonModel.setPressed(Unknown Source)
at javax.swing.plaf.basic.BasicButtonListener.mouseReleased(Unknown Source)
at java.awt.Component.processMouseEvent(Unknown Source)
at javax.swing.JComponent.processMouseEvent(Unknown Source)
at java.awt.Component.processEvent(Unknown Source)
at java.awt.Container.processEvent(Unknown Source)
at java.awt.Component.dispatchEventImpl(Unknown Source)
at java.awt.Container.dispatchEventImpl(Unknown Source)
at java.awt.Component.dispatchEvent(Unknown Source)
at java.awt.LightweightDispatcher.retargetMouseEvent(Unknown Source)
at java.awt.LightweightDispatcher.processMouseEvent(Unknown Source)
at java.awt.LightweightDispatcher.dispatchEvent(Unknown Source)
at java.awt.Container.dispatchEventImpl(Unknown Source)
at java.awt.Window.dispatchEventImpl(Unknown Source)
at java.awt.Component.dispatchEvent(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$500(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(Unknown Source)
at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ue$4.run(Unknown Source)
at java.awt.EventQueue$4.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)
Caused by: mondrian.olap.MondrianException: Mondrian Error:Internal error: while parsing catalog file:C:/Users/utilisateur/AppData/Local/Temp/openconcerto2569619356526396511.xml
at mondrian.resource.MondrianResource$_Def0.ex(MondrianResource.java:912)
at mondrian.olap.Util.newInternal(Util.java:2038)
at mondrian.olap.Util.newError(Util.java:2054)
at mondrian.rolap.RolapSchema.load(RolapSchema.java:436)
at mondrian.rolap.RolapSchema.<init>(RolapSchema.java:240)
at mondrian.rolap.RolapSchema.<init>(RolapSchema.java:60)
at mondrian.rolap.RolapSchema$Pool.get(RolapSchema.java:1121)
at mondrian.rolap.RolapSchema$Pool.get(RolapSchema.java:913)
at mondrian.rolap.RolapConnection.<init>(RolapConnection.java:151)
at mondrian.rolap.RolapConnection.<init>(RolapConnection.java:87)
at mondrian.olap.DriverManager.getConnection(DriverManager.java:112)
at mondrian.olap.DriverManager.getConnection(DriverManager.java:71)
at mondrian.olap4j.MondrianOlap4jConnection.<init>(MondrianOlap4jConnection.java:135)
at mondrian.olap4j.FactoryJdbc4Impl$MondrianOlap4jConnectionJdbc4.<init>(FactoryJdbc4Impl.java:369)
at mondrian.olap4j.FactoryJdbc4Impl.newConnection(FactoryJdbc4Impl.java:34)
at mondrian.olap4j.MondrianOlap4jDriver.connect(MondrianOlap4jDriver.java:119)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at org.openconcerto.modules.reports.olap.OLAPPanel.reload(OLAPPanel.java:47)
... 37 more
Caused by: org.eigenbase.xom.XOMException: Document parse failed
at org.eigenbase.xom.wrappers.JaxpDOMParser.parseInputSource(Unknown Source)
at org.eigenbase.xom.wrappers.GenericDOMParser.parse(Unknown Source)
at mondrian.rolap.RolapSchema.load(RolapSchema.java:392)
... 52 more
Caused by: com.sun.org.apache.xerces.internal.impl.io.MalformedByteSequenceException: Octet 2 de la séquence UTF-8 à 3 octets non valide.
at com.sun.org.apache.xerces.internal.impl.io.UTF8Reader.invalidByte(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.io.UTF8Reader.read(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.load(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LEntityScanner.scanLiteral(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LScanner.scanAttributeValue(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anAttribute(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anStartElement(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Driver.next(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entScannerImpl.next(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.DOMParser.parse(Unknown Source)
at com.sun.org.apache.xerces.internal.jaxp.DocumentBuilderImpl.parse(Unknown Source)
... 55 more

Je n'arrive pas a comprendre le dysfonctionnement.
Merci pour votre aide précieuse.

Alex

Re: OLAP est en erreur

Posté : dim. janv. 22, 2017 10:20 pm
par guillaume
Bonjour,

On a déjà croisé ce bug une fois sur Mac, l'encodage des caractères accentués est à l'origine de se problème.

Corrigez votre fichier de configuration des hypercubes OLAP.

Cordialement,

Re: OLAP est en erreur

Posté : dim. avr. 23, 2017 2:07 pm
par doc
Bonjour,

Je rencontre le même soucis, et effectivement les "é" sont mal encodés dans le fichier généré, je le corrige et en met une copie nommée openconcerto_catalog.xml dans le dossier configuration mais OpenConcerto ne le trouve pas et essaie de régénérer un fichier temporaire (re-buggé évidemment). Est ce bien dans le dossier Configuration que le fichier de configuration des hypercubes OLAP doit se trouver ??

Merci.

Cordialement.

Re: OLAP est en erreur

Posté : dim. avr. 23, 2017 2:15 pm
par guillaume
Bonjour,

De mémoire, dans le dossier de l'appli.

Cordialement,